ISLAMABAD, Jul 27 (APP): Deputy Inspector General (DIG) Security Rana Umar Farooq on Monday reviewed the arrangements for the ongoing Islamabad Police recruitment process during a visit to the recruitment venue at F-9 Park and directed officers to ensure that the entire exercise is conducted strictly on merit and with complete transparency.

An ICT Police spokesperson told APP that the DIG Umar also chaired a meeting on the recruitment process, attended by the officers concerned.

The meeting reviewed arrangements for the recruitment drive, administrative matters and the implementation of the prescribed recruitment procedures.

DIG Umar directed the officers to complete every stage of the recruitment process in accordance with the approved rules and regulations, ensuring merit, transparency and equal opportunities for all candidates.
Earlier, he visited the recruitment site at F-9 Park, inspected the arrangements in place and issued necessary instructions to the relevant officers for the smooth, transparent and orderly conduct of the recruitment process.
He emphasized that Islamabad Police remained committed to recruiting competent personnel through a fair, transparent and merit-based selection process
